What Are Ketamine Crystals?

Ketamine typically exists in one of two forms: liquid or solid. The solid form can appear as a powder or in larger, more defined ketamine crystals. These crystals are the purified, crystallized version of ketamine hydrochloride. In pharmaceutical manufacturing, crystallization is a common process used to isolate and purify substances. In the case of ketamine, crystallization helps ensure consistency, potency, and ease of handling for specific applications.

Why Is Some Ketamine Crystallized?

  1. Purity and Stability
    Crystallization allows ketamine to be stored in a stable form. The crystalline structure resists moisture, oxygen, and degradation better than some other forms. This makes ketamine crystals ideal for long-term storage and accurate dosing.

  2. Pharmaceutical Production Standards
    During production, ketamine hydrochloride is often crystallized for consistency. Crystals can then be ground into fine powder or dissolved into liquid, depending on the intended use. The crystalline form ensures a uniform composition, which is vital for clinical and veterinary uses.

  3. Recreational or Non-Medical Use
    Outside of medical contexts, some ketamine is diverted into non-regulated markets, where it is often sold in crystal form before being crushed into powder. In these settings, the crystals are typically preferred by users for their perceived purity and effectiveness.

  4. Recrystallization for Purification
    Some people intentionally recrystallize ketamine to remove adulterants or impurities. This practice, though not safe or recommended, is a reason why people might encounter large, glassy ketamine crystals in illicit contexts.

Are Crystals Better Than Powder?

Medically, there is no inherent advantage of ketamine crystals over powder unless purity or solubility is a concern. However, some believe that ketamine crystals provide a cleaner experience due to fewer additives. This perception can be misleading, as street-market ketamine is not subject to quality controls, regardless of its form.
